Ubuntu 22.04 Jammy Jellyfish es la última versión de esta popular distribución de Linux, al menos al momento de escribir estas líneas. Incluye muchas actualizaciones y novedades, pero tiene un inconveniente con los puertos USB que puede ocasionar que no podamos programar nuestras placas ESP o Arduino. En este artículo te muestro como resolverlo de una manera sencilla
ST
Programando en bloques con Nairda
Si bien existen muchos lenguajes de programación gráficos o de bloques para Arduino y los ESP, Nairda se destaca por la posibilidad de programar distintos modelos de placas empleando un teléfono móvil o tablet a través de un enlace Bluetooth, sin la necesidad de contar con una computadora. En este artículo haré una revisión de este desarrollo contándoles un poco sus principales características y aplicaciones.
Introducción a la placa Nucleo-64 F303RE
La empresa ST pone a disposición de los usuarios numerosos modelos de placas de evaluación para probar las capacidades de los distintos micros de la familia STM32. Dentro de la línea de placas Nucleo se encuentra la F303RE que nos permite evaluar las posibilidades del micro F303RET6. En este artículo haremos una descripción de la placa y sus posibilidades y daremos un vistazo a las numerosas opciones que tenemos para programarla.
Conectando un LCD I2C a una STM32 Blue Pill usando Arduino IDE
Los display LCD de caracteres pueden conectarse de forma directa a un microcontrolador, pero esto demanda una gran cantidad de pines. Afortunadamente existen módulos, como los basados en el chip PCF8574 que resuelven este problema al permitir la conexión usando sólo los dos pines del bus I2C. En este artículo veremos como controlar un LCD con uno de estos módulos desde una placa STM32 Blue Pill programada en el Arduino IDE.
Programando la STM32 Blue Pill con el Cube Ide. Parte 2: Código y depuración
En la primera parte de este artículo vimos como descargar e instalar el Cube Ide, iniciar un proyecto y configurar el micro y sus periféricos con el Cube MX. En esta segunda y última parte nos ocuparemos del código que debemos escribir, veremos que son las librerías LL y HAL y como grabar el micro y probarlo.
Programando la STM32 Blue Pill con el Cube Ide. Parte 1: Instalación y configuración
La Blue Pill, como todas las placas basadas en los micros STM32 tienen una amplia variedad de herramientas de desarrollo a su disposición, muchas de ellas totalmente gratuitas. En este artículo haré una introducción al uso del Cube Ide, una completísima herramienta de ST.
Programando la STM32 Blue Pill con Arduino IDE. Parte 3: Uso de adaptador FTDI
Ya vimos en los artículos anteriores de esta serie como configurar el Arduino IDE para programar la Blue Pill y grabarle programas empleando el grabador/depurador ST-Link. En este artículo les voy a mostrar como hacerlo usando una placa adaptadora USB tipo FTDI.
Programando la STM32 Blue Pill con Arduino IDE. Parte 2: uso de ST-Link
En la primera parte de esta serie de artículos dedicados a la programación de la Blue Pill con el IDE de Arduino vimos como instalar el core del STM32 y el programa STM32CubeProgrammer, junto a todos los drivers necesarios. En esta segunda parte nos concentraremos en el proceso de grabación utilizando el programador/depurador ST-Link.